Experience the vibrant summer month of July in Aalborg, Denmark, where temperatures can soar to a pleasant 29°C (85°F), providing the perfect backdrop for outdoor activities. With an average temperature of 17°C (63°F), the climate remains comfortable, while nighttime lows dip to a refreshing 8°C (46°F). July also sees 80 mm (3.2 in) of precipitation over 13 days, contributing to the lush greenery that enhances the city’s charm. Coupled with a humidity level of 78%, this month offers a unique blend of warmth and freshness, making it an ideal time to explore Aalborg’s picturesque landscapes and cultural offerings.

In July, Aalborg experiences a notable peak in precipitation, with 80 mm (3.2 in) falling over 13 days, marking it as one of the wettest months of the year. This uptick closely follows the rainfall patterns observed in June, which also saw substantial precipitation at 71 mm (2.8 in), suggesting a trend toward wetter summer months. The increase in rainfall from June to July hints at an impending shift towards the more humid conditions often characteristic of late summer, setting the stage for the even higher precipitation totals anticipated in August. In Aalborg, Denmark, July marks a subtle shift in humidity, with levels settling at 78%. While this is a slight increase from the preceding month of June at 77%, it reflects a broader trend of progressively changing humidity throughout the year. The beginning of the year experiences its highest humidity, peaking at 88% in January. As spring evolves into summer, we see a gradual decline, dropping to its lowest point of 79% in May. However, as midsummer approaches, humidity levels begin to rise again, signaling the transition into the more humid conditions typical of late summer and early autumn. This cyclical dance of moisture levels exemplifies Aalborg's maritime climate, where humidity remains a constant feature throughout the year.
In July, Aalborg experiences a high UV Index of 7, consistent with the trend established in June. With a burn time of just 25 minutes, it's crucial to take protective measures when enjoying the sun. This month, along with June, marks the peak of UV exposure, highlighting the importance of being sun-smart during the summer. As the year progresses, the UV Index illustrates a clear pattern: starting from low levels in winter, it steadily rises through spring, reaching its zenith in mid-summer before beginning to taper off in August. In Aalborg, Denmark, July shines as the pinnacle of summer sunshine, offering an impressive 468 hours of bright days that beckon residents and visitors alike to embrace the outdoors. This peak in sunlight follows a gradual upward trend from the year’s start, where January only offers a modest 97 hours. As spring unfolds, the hours steadily increase, culminating in June's 458 hours, but it is July that truly delights with nearly 10 more hours of sunshine than its predecessor. Following this sun-soaked month, the hours begin to taper off, indicating the slow transition into autumn. In Aalborg, Denmark, the progression of daylight duration throughout the year showcases a remarkable shift, peaking in the summer months. By July, residents enjoy a generous 17 hours of daylight, mirroring the heights reached in June. This extended brightness enhances outdoor activities and community life amidst the beautiful Scandinavian summer. As the year transitions into August, daylight begins to wane, with hours decreasing to 15, signaling the onset of autumn.
